Output f50329240efbad077acc590b98c948d72593a78210f012695c0d102c0327df5e:1

value
905804
script pubkey
OP_0 OP_PUSHBYTES_20 eedadb303e81c2de24ef944312e1739d329d793c
address
bc1qamddkvp7s8pduf80j3p39ctnn5ef67futt5nsl
transaction
f50329240efbad077acc590b98c948d72593a78210f012695c0d102c0327df5e
confirmations
167118
spent
true